Rajasthan
AJMER, JULY 4 .The annual urs of Sufi saint Khwaja Moinuddin Chisti, which attracts pilgrims from all over the country and abroad, will begin at his dargah here next month, the dargah committee announced here today. It would begin on August 17 or 18 subject to visibility of moon and will conclude on August 22 or 23, a dargah committee spokesman said. The Jumma Namaz will be held on August 20, he said. The flag hoisting ceremony will be held on August 12 at Buland Darwaja of the dargah to herald the coming of urs. The holy flag accompanied by hundreds of devotees, qawal parties and bands is brought in a procession from nearby dargah committee office for its ceremonious hoisting atop Buland Darwaja. Arrangements for the urs have begun with the dargah building getting a facelift and tents being erected to cover areas near main mausoleum in view of the rainy season. PTI
